矿石收音机论坛

 找回密码
 加入会员

QQ登录

只需一步,快速开始

搜索
123
返回列表 发新帖
楼主: 乙猪

学习51单片机编程,显示TM1637模块

[复制链接]
     
发表于 2022-5-4 18:16:04 | 显示全部楼层
girlexplorer 发表于 2022-5-2 21:10
想当年,老衲不止一次想学一下c语言。
只是看到那个既非常麻烦又毫无用处的指针,就打消了老衲的念头。

指针效率高,很灵活,其实就是和汇编里面的寻址方式一样,是改良板,类型安全,除了void*
回复 支持 反对

使用道具 举报

     
 楼主| 发表于 2022-5-5 11:09:28 | 显示全部楼层
girlexplorer 发表于 2022-5-2 21:10
想当年,老衲不止一次想学一下c语言。
只是看到那个既非常麻烦又毫无用处的指针,就打消了老衲的念头。

C语言要在函数间传递数组数据,一定要用到指针。
所有语言都有指针,避无可避。
C51比C语言简单,又可结合硬件来玩,比较有意思。
回复 支持 反对

使用道具 举报

     
发表于 2022-5-6 17:41:34 来自手机 | 显示全部楼层
1638,1650类我项目用过,注意一个问题,模拟通讯时候,不要被int,定时器等打断频度过高,不然会 出现显示错误。乱码,按键无法操作之类问题。解决方法只能尽可能提高主频,优化调度机制,或者使用外设来驱动比较好。   之前走的弯路大家参考。

评分

1

查看全部评分

回复 支持 反对

使用道具 举报

     
发表于 2024-10-25 15:17:54 | 显示全部楼层
CXFLBH 发表于 2022-4-18 08:41
1637这个是比较奇特的芯片,明明是共阳驱动,却用了一个共阴的数据表。4位数码管用1637浪费了,用1650足够 ...

就是,1637为什么共阴的数据表呢?
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 加入会员

本版积分规则

小黑屋|手机版|矿石收音机 ( 蒙ICP备05000029号-1 )

蒙公网安备 15040402000005号

GMT+8, 2025-4-28 20:12

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表